ABSTRACT:
A constant multiplication device is designed for multiplying a received binary multiplicand by a constant multiplier which, when expressed in binary or signed-digit notation, includes a repeated pattern with three or more non-zero values. The device includes a pattern-product term generator that receives the multiplicand and generates terms corresponding to each of the non-zero values of the pattern. If, when all instances of the pattern are subtracted from the multiplier there are non-zero values in the difference, the pattern-product term generator can also generate remainder-product terms. The pattern-product terms, but not the remainder-product terms, are input to a pattern compressor that yields pattern-product partials; the compressor can be a carry-save adder and the partials can be in the form of a pseudo sum and a pseudo carry. A replica generator generates shifted replicas of each pattern-product partial. The replicas are input to a replica compressor, as are any remainder-product terms. The replica compressor converts these inputs to final-product partials. The replica compressor can be a carry-save adder and the final-product partials can be a pseudo sum and a pseudo carry. These are input to a product ripple accumulator, which can be a carry-propagate adder, to yield the product of the multiplicand and the multiplier. Since there is only one ripple stage, the device provides for relatively high-speed multiplication for multipliers with repeated patterns.
